The UDI (Unique Device Identification) is the unique identification system mandated by Article 27 of the MDR. Its purpose: to ensure the traceability of every medical device from manufacture to patient, and to feed the EUDAMED database with reliable data on products placed on the market.
The structure of a UDI
A UDI is made up of two distinct parts, which serve different purposes. The UDI-DI (Device Identifier) identifies the model or commercial reference of the device. It is specific to each version and to each level of packaging. A significant change to the device (new version, new packaging, change of sterilisation process) requires a new UDI-DI; the list of cases is set out in Annex VI, Part C of the regulation. The UDI-PI (Production Identifier) identifies the production unit: lot number, serial number, manufacturing date, expiry date. It changes with each lot or unit manufactured. The complete UDI applied to the label combines UDI-DI and UDI-PI.
The Basic UDI-DI, the identifier no one sees but everyone requires
The system’s third identifier, and the first point of confusion in SMEs: the Basic UDI-DI. It never appears on the label. It groups together devices that share the same intended purpose, the same risk class and the same essential design and manufacturing characteristics. Yet it is what structures everything else. The Basic UDI-DI is the main access key for EUDAMED registrations. It appears on the EU declaration of conformity and on the certificates issued by the notified body. The MDCG 2018-1 guide sets out its allocation rules. The classic mistake is to confuse it with the UDI-DI and to multiply Basic UDI-DIs reference by reference. The result: an unmanageable EUDAMED tree structure and certificates to be revised at the first grouping. The grouping logic is decided before the first allocation, not after.
The issuing entities
The manufacturer does not allocate its own UDI codes. It goes through an issuing entity designated by the European Commission (Implementing Decision (EU) 2019/939, designations renewed until 27 June 2029 by Decision (EU) 2024/2120). Four entities are designated: GS1: uses the GTIN format. It is the most widely used entity in the medical device sector in Europe. Membership provides access to a GS1 Company Prefix, from which the manufacturer builds its product codes. HIBCC: HIBC format, more common in North America. ICCBBA: ISBT 128 format, used mainly for products of human origin and cell therapies. IFA GmbH: German entity, PPN format, originating from the pharmaceutical channel. Relevant for manufacturers whose products already circulate in the German pharmaceutical distribution chain.
The accepted marking formats
The UDI must appear on the label in a human-readable format (HRI) and in a machine-readable format (AIDC). The GS1 Data Matrix is the sector’s most common format. For reusable devices reprocessed between two uses (cleaning, disinfection, sterilisation), direct marking on the device itself is an obligation, not an option, unless a documented technical impossibility applies. This obligation follows its own timetable, offset by two years from the label: May 2023 for class III and implantables, May 2025 for classes IIa and IIb, May 2027 for class I.
The application deadlines by class
The application of the UDI on the label has been in effect since May 2021 for class III and implantables, May 2023 for classes IIa and IIb, May 2025 for class I (Article 123 of the MDR). Registration in EUDAMED follows a separate timetable. Since 28 May 2026, the use of the first four modules is mandatory, including the UDI/devices module. In concrete terms: across all classes, a manufacturer placing a device on the market must now have registered its Basic UDI-DIs and UDI-DIs in the database. The period when registration was voluntary is over. Manufacturers still under directive certificates under the transitional regime of Article 120 must check their situation on a case-by-case basis: “legacy” devices follow specific registration arrangements, with their own EUDAMED identifiers. For manufacturers established outside the Union, these registration obligations for non-EU manufacturers rest in part on the authorised representative, who verifies that the devices it represents are indeed registered.
What this means in practice
UDI implementation follows a sequence in which each step conditions the next: choose an issuing entity, obtain a prefix, decide the grouping logic for Basic UDI-DIs, allocate UDI-DIs reference by reference, integrate UDI-PIs into the manufacturing and labelling processes, register everything in EUDAMED, then formalise a UDI management procedure in the QMS for future changes. The bottleneck is almost never the code itself. It is the grouping decision taken too quickly, upstream, without anticipating the product variants of the next three years. A class I manufacturer with forty references and reusable devices has two projects ahead: an already-due EUDAMED registration, and direct marking to organise before May 2027. Engraving a Data Matrix on an existing instrument affects the manufacturing process, sometimes the technical documentation. Twelve months of industrial lead time is nothing exceptional.
